water pepper: (not in Weeds of the Great Plains, nor Weeds of the Northeast)
o summer annual, similar to Pennsylvania smartweed in appearance, but leaves are narrower and sometimes longer, and inflorescence has individual florets more spaced out on the main rachis
o not usually a weed problem—a native plant of streambanks and wetland areas
